LAFC have beaten David Beckham's Inter Miami to be named Forbes' most valuable MLS club for the third year running.

LAFC were valued at $1.25 billion, according to Forbes, up 4% from last year, and close to double the average value of the league's 29 teams. Inter Miami have enjoyed a surge of sponsorships and fan engagement since signing Lionel Messi in 2023 and rose 17% in value to claim second place.

Miami's valuation has doubled as a result of the Messi signing but it was not enough to top LAFC on the list. The Argentina legend helped his side claim 74 regular season points in 2024 before the team suffered a shock first-round exit from the playoffs – but their valuation has doubled since 2022 and seems set to keep rising with Messi at the club.

MLS Cup champions LA Galaxy were valued at $1B in third place, while Atlanta United ($975M) and New York City FC ($875M) completed the top five. Expansion club San Diego FC were omitted from the ranking.
FORBES' TOP 10 MOST VALUABLE MLS TEAMS 2025
POSITION
TEAM
VALUE
1)
LAFC
$1.25B
2)
Inter Miami
$1.2B
3)
LA Galaxy
$1B
4)
Atlanta United
$975M
5)
New York City FC
$875M
6)
Austin FC
$825M
7)
Seattle Sounders
$800M
8)
D.C. United
$785M
9)
Columbus Crew
$735M
10)
FC Cincinnati
$730M
